Jaden’s aim was true even in his currently injured state. Flexing his shoulders to pull power into his bow string, he noticed for the first time where the black fighter had ripped at his flesh. He could feel the hot blood trailing down his chest and wetting the fur on his ribs. He let the strung arrow fly with a wince. The shaft would have flown strait for his intended secui target had the woman before him evaded it entirely. He put his own hope, however detrimental it seemed, into his opponent and she had so nearly let the arrow fly free. But it grazed her. The slight course correction was more than enough to let the arrow fall away from it’s target harmlessly.

The attack had been intended to be a martyred attempt to save his leader. Had the now crazed-looking white eyed wolf dodged his arrow as intended, Jaden would have been left with no time to defend himself from another attack. Even after he missed he was still left with no time to dodge. A powerful kick struck the bow in his possession, destroying it with a loud shattering of wood that spattered the archer and the woman with sharp splinters. The shock of impact on his hands was painful and his reaction was to pull them back, leaving him open for the follow up kick. It hit hard and knocked the man flat on his tail. He followed the fall back into a roll and stayed low when his paws found ground again. The earthy colors of the forest and the powerful sounds of battle seemed to be crushing down and his entire body felt like it had been trampled by a horse. He was loosing this fight and he knew it. He had to find a way out before one of the dark wolf’s kicks landed hard enough to break him.

Jaden had already curled into a defensive crouch by the time he realized his opponent was running away. The shock of such it froze him in place, completely dumbfounded with black and gold gauntlets at the ready. She was obviously a better fighter and he was most vulnerable now…

His ponderings were cut short when he noticed Terra snap at the dark optime. With her injuries it seemed like a stupid move. But her eyes found his and he realized her intent. She wanted him to escape. They were retreating.

The bloodied man stood and took two steps before stumbling to his knees. The pain in him was worse than he had expected and as he looked down he realized why. Two three-inch long splinters of his smashed bow protruded out of his body, one from his thigh and one from his left bicep. He yanked one after another free from his frame with a few successive curses and pushed up again, charging away from the hostile group as fast as he could. He glanced at his comrades as they disappeared into the land and wanted to follow but the distance between them was quickly filled with pursuing Salsolans. Instead, he cut to the far right and decided he would just take a slightly longer way around to the boarder. Adrenalin assured that he was still quick on his paws despite his injuries and he knew Terra’s distraction would help him dissolve into the forest’s shadows and hopefully without attracting any more attention.
